Sunscreen fabric is a high-performance technical textile specifically designed to provide effective solar shading while maintaining natural daylight and outward visibility. It is commonly used in roller blinds, vertical blinds, and architectural shading systems for both residential and commercial environments.
Sunscreen fabric is typically made from fiberglass or polyester yarns coated with PVC, forming a durable mesh structure with a specific openness factor—a measure of how much light and visibility the fabric allows through. This unique construction enables it to block up to 95% of harmful UV rays, reduce solar heat gain, and significantly lower energy consumption in buildings.
Unlike blackout or opaque fabrics, sunscreen fabric strikes a balance between light control, thermal insulation, privacy, and visual comfort. It protects indoor furnishings from fading, reduces glare on screens, and improves occupant well-being—all while preserving an open, spacious feel.

Advantages of Sunscreen Fabric
Superior UV Protection
Engineered to block up to 95% of harmful ultraviolet rays, sunscreen fabric helps protect indoor furnishings, flooring, and occupants from sun damage and discoloration, extending the life of interior assets.
Effective Solar Heat Control
By filtering solar radiation, this fabric significantly reduces indoor heat gain, thereby lowering air-conditioning costs and contributing to improved energy efficiency in residential and commercial buildings.
Optimized Daylight Management
Sunscreen fabric allows controlled amounts of natural light to enter while minimizing glare, creating a comfortable and well-lit indoor environment without the need for artificial lighting during the day.
Enhanced Visual Comfort and Privacy
The mesh structure ensures outward visibility during daylight hours while providing daytime privacy. This dual benefit supports both occupant well-being and architectural aesthetics.
High Durability and Low Maintenance
Manufactured from high-tensile fiberglass or polyester yarns coated with PVC, the fabric offers excellent dimensional stability, resistance to mold, moisture, and UV degradation, and is easy to clean and maintain.
Versatile Applications
Suitable for roller blinds, vertical blinds, panel tracks, and exterior shading systems, sunscreen fabric is widely used in offices, hotels, healthcare facilities, and smart building environments.

Key Points in Choosing Sunscreen Fabric
Openness Factor (OF%)
The openness factor determines how much light and visibility the fabric allows. Common options include 1%, 3%, 5%, and 10%.
Lower OF (1–3%): Better glare control and privacy
Higher OF (5–10%): More natural light and outside visibility
Choose based on the building’s orientation, window size, and lighting needs.
UV Protection Rate
High-quality sunscreen fabrics should block at least 90–95% of harmful UV rays. This prevents fading of interior furnishings and protects occupant health—especially important for homes, offices, and healthcare facilities.
Thermal and Energy Performance
Evaluate the fabric's ability to reflect solar heat and reduce indoor temperature. Fabrics with high solar reflectance and low solar absorption improve HVAC efficiency and reduce energy consumption.
Fire-Retardant Certification
Ensure the fabric meets international fire safety standards (e.g., NFPA 701, B1, M1). This is especially important in commercial buildings, hotels, hospitals, and public areas where fire compliance is mandatory.
Material Composition
Look for high-quality fiberglass or polyester with PVC coating.
- Fiberglass base: Offers dimensional stability, flame resistance, and longer lifespan
- Polyester base: More flexible and cost-effective
Choose according to application needs and budget.
Color Selection
Color affects not only aesthetics but also light control and heat performance.
- Light colors: Reflect more heat, brighten interiors
- Dark colors: Offer better glare control and privacy
Select color based on design requirements and solar control goals.
Durability and Maintenance
Check for fabric properties such as anti-mildew, moisture resistance, abrasion resistance, and UV stability. A good sunscreen fabric should maintain its form and function for years with minimal maintenance.
Application Compatibility
Confirm the fabric is compatible with your system—manual or motorized roller blinds, vertical blinds, panel tracks, or outdoor shading systems. Consider weight, flexibility, and ease of cutting for fabrication and installation.
How to Work with Sunscreen Fabric
1. Storage and Handling
· Store rolls in a clean, dry, ventilated area, away from direct sunlight and moisture.
· Keep the fabric in its original packaging until ready for use to avoid dust, wrinkles, and edge damage.
· Avoid folding or creasing, as this may affect the coating or fabric structure.
2. Cutting
Use automated cutting machines or sharp rotary blades to achieve clean, precise edges.
Follow the fabric’s grain direction to maintain tension and prevent warping during installation.
Use heat-cutting tools or ultrasonic cutters when possible to seal edges and avoid fraying, especially for fiberglass base fabrics.
3. Edge Treatment
Depending on the system used (roller blinds, panels, or zip-track), consider welding, sewing, or taping the edges for durability.
Some high-end installations may require reinforced borders or weight bars to ensure smooth operation and a neat appearance.
4. Seaming and Joining
For large-width applications, fabrics may need to be joined using high-frequency welding, thermal bonding, or double-sided adhesive tapes.
Always ensure color and weave alignment for visual consistency.
5. Fabrication for Shading Systems
Confirm fabric thickness and flexibility are compatible with your system (manual or motorized).
Coordinate with system suppliers to meet tolerance requirements in width and drop.
Install tension systems or bottom bars to keep the fabric flat and prevent curling or sagging.
6. Cleaning and Maintenance
Clean regularly with a soft brush or vacuum to remove dust.
For deeper cleaning, use mild soap and lukewarm water. Avoid abrasive tools or harsh chemicals.
Rinse thoroughly and let the fabric dry naturally—never use high heat or tumble dryers.
7. Safety Considerations
Wear gloves and safety glasses when cutting fiberglass fabrics to prevent irritation from fine fibers.
Ensure proper ventilation if using adhesives or welding equipment during fabrication.
8. Installation Tips
Test fit the fabric in the system before final installation.
Use laser levels to ensure alignment and straight drop.
Secure with end caps, guide wires, or zip-track mechanisms for outdoor applications.

Factors Affecting the Lifespan of Sunscreen Fabric
Material Quality and Coating Technology
The durability of sunscreen fabric largely depends on its core material—typically fiberglass or polyester—and the quality of the PVC coating.
- Fiberglass base offers superior dimensional stability, UV resistance, and flame retardancy.
- High-quality PVC coatings enhance weather resistance, reduce cracking, and maintain color stability over time.
Choosing certified, well-manufactured fabric ensures long-lasting performance.
Environmental Exposure
External factors such as UV intensity, humidity, wind, and pollution significantly impact longevity.
- Indoor use typically offers a lifespan of 8–10 years or more.
- Outdoor use (patios, balconies) may shorten lifespan due to sun, rain, and temperature fluctuations unless the fabric is specifically rated for exterior conditions.
Cleaning and Maintenance
Routine cleaning prevents dust, mold, and air pollutants from degrading the surface.
- Use mild soap and soft cloth or brushes; avoid harsh chemicals or high-pressure washing.
- Proper care not only preserves appearance but also protects structural integrity over time.
